Rustic mantels are similar in style to farmhouse and cottage, but a little more worn and weathered-looking. Make sure your mirror reflects the actual room and not the ceiling or opposing blank wall. Choose a mirror that’s at least half of the mantel’s width so it doesn’t look too small. An extra-wide fireplace will look better with a rectangular mirror rather than a square one. Next, consider the size of your mirror it needs to be proportional to your fireplace’s size and shape. Modern fireplace mirror could have a simple frame with clean lines or skip the frame entirely. A farmhouse, country, or cottage fireplace might blend better with a mirror with a window frame over it.
